Pycharm结合Robotframework执行自动化测试
今天发现pycharm下可以开发robotframework,记录下:
1.安装语法高亮IntelliBot插件:
2.配置文件类型识别
配置识别
3.suite的运行配置
- -d results
-
suite运行配置
4.case的运行配置
- -d results -t "" ./
5.简单代码块test.txt
*** Settings ***
Library Selenium2Library
*** Test Cases ***
Chrome测试
Open Browser http://www.baidu.com chrome
Input Text id=kw test
Click button id=su
Sleep 1.5
Capture Page Screenshot hello.png
Close Browser
6.运行
suit运行:
case运行:
out2
f**k,明明公司可以的,还特意检查了
3.1的robotframework开始使用robot解析器 其他pybot,jybot ,ipybot 都不用了
7.问题排查
选错误了。。。。。。近视比较严重(滑稽)
滑稽8.路径也有问题:
- suit:
-d results $FileDir$
- case:
-d results $FileName$
9.再来一次
输出
输出报告
报告注意
- 安装完插件需要重启pycharm
- 如果python环境下或者Anaconda环境下的Scripts文件夹有加入环境变量,可以在系统cmd窗口
robot.exe -h
查看全部命令 - Python版本3.6+Robotframework3.1.1
- 遇到了再来补充
网友评论